2 Chronicles, Chapter 4

   1: And he made a brazen altar: its length was twenty cubits, and its breadth twenty cubits, and its height ten cubits.
   2: And he made the sea, molten, ten cubits from brim to brim, round all about; and its height was five cubits; and a line of thirty cubits encompassed it round about.
   3: And under it was the similitude of oxen, encompassing it round about, ten in a cubit enclosing the sea round about, two rows of oxen, cast when it was cast.
   4: It stood upon twelve oxen, three looking toward the north, and three looking toward the west, and three looking toward the south, and three looking toward the east; and the sea was above upon them, and all their hinder parts were inward.
   5: And its thickness was a hand-breadth, and its brim like the work of the brim of a cup, with lily-blossoms; in capacity it held three thousand baths.
   6: And he made ten lavers, and put five on the right and five on the left, to wash in them: they rinsed in them what they prepared for the burnt-offering; and the sea was for the priests to wash in.
   7: And he made ten candlesticks of gold according to the ordinance respecting them, and set them in the temple, five on the right hand and five on the left.
   8: And he made ten tables, and placed them in the temple, five on the right hand and five on the left. And he made a hundred golden bowls.
   9: And he made the court of the priests, and the great court, and doors for the court, and overlaid the doors thereof with bronze.
   10: And he set the sea on the right side eastward, over against the south.
   11: And Huram made the pots and the shovels and the bowls. So Huram ended doing the work that he made for king Solomon in the house of God:
   12: two pillars, and the globes and the capitals on the top of the pillars, two; and the two networks, to cover the two globes of the capitals which were on the top of the pillars;
   13: and the four hundred pomegranates for the two networks, two rows of pomegranates for one network, to cover the two globes of the capitals which were upon the pillars.
   14: And he made the bases, and he made the lavers on the bases;
   15: one sea, and the twelve oxen under it.
   16: And the pots, and the shovels, and the forks, and all their instruments did Huram Abiv make king Solomon for the house of Jehovah, of bright brass.
   17: In the plain of the Jordan did the king cast them, in the clay-ground between Succoth and Zeredathah.
   18: And Solomon made all these vessels in great number; for the weight of the brass was not ascertained.
   19: And Solomon made all the vessels that were [in] the house of God: the golden altar; and the tables whereon was the shewbread;
   20: and the candlesticks with their lamps to burn according to the ordinance before the oracle, of pure gold;
   21: and the flowers, and the lamps, and the tongs, of gold (it was perfect gold);
   22: and the knives, and the bowls, and the cups, and the censers, of pure gold; and the entrance of the house, the inner folding-doors thereof for the most holy place, and the doors of the house, of the temple, of gold.
